Output d74c2a91b4dd567276058c35e0611b85c4ef08e375a61142c3b7fe3c734633e2:8

value
9564202
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c64088d77df423d54941aefd210321edb763bf1d OP_EQUAL
address
3KmH2TtpR4xLyrYJs495kRVQYvFRb7tgfC
transaction
d74c2a91b4dd567276058c35e0611b85c4ef08e375a61142c3b7fe3c734633e2
spent
true